1. In what year did you buy your SC? 2008

2. What year is your SC? 1998

3. Roughly how many miles did the SC have when you bought it? 163K

4. Do you feel you got a good deal (did the car break down after purchase, incur high repair costs, etc)? I think it was a great deal. People buy beater cars for similar money and they pour thousands into them to keep them going as they frequently have problems. The LCAs went out about 2 years after purchase and that was the most expensive repair at $700+ in parts. I redid the front end with OEM struts, bushings, end links, etc as well. A DIY service with all OEM parts cost over $1100 in parts but I did major parts replacement to not have to worry about it. Pretty much every rubber hose/line was replaced including the stock air ducting to the intake. A set of Michelin tires 4 years in cost $850. I drove to cross country once and it was flawless. It left me stuck on the road only once when the starter went out. It's on the 2nd battery with me; about $120 each time. Next up are rear shocks but for the next 55K miles it just needs gas and oil. The radiator will probably fail in this car before my next major service but that's plastic tank radiators in any car.

5. Roughly how much did you pay for your SC? $5K
